Post Falls' Slaney wins national art contest

| March 30, 2010 9:00 PM

Post Falls High senior Meaghan Slaney is the first winner of the national Artsonia Idol Contest, an online art contest for high schoolers.

She was among three finalists heading into last weekend out of more than 500 entrants. This is the first year of the contest.

Slaney, who plans to attend Boise State University this fall and major in art, won $1,000 worth of art supplies and $500 for her school's art program with the first-place finish. Earlier in the contest, she won magnets and prints of her artwork and items at the Artsonia gift shop.

Entrants must submit art in five categories - Design, Imagination, People, Nature and Artist's Choice.

The judges and the public each made up 50 percent of the vote to determine the winner.
